project was the Assessment of Impacts from the Baghjan Oil
Blowout in Assam, under the guidance of Dr Shalini Dhyani.
Thereafter, I worked at the North Eastern Space Applications
Centre, where I identified forest gaps, detected opium poppy
plantations across Manipur, and analysed land-use change. I
used R programming to estimate the concentration of trace
gases using satellite data while working at Cotton University.
Currently, I work as a consultant for Disaster
Risk Reduction and Management in Kaziranga Tiger Reserve under
the Wildlife Trust of India, where we are pioneering the first
Disaster Management Plan for a protected area in India.
